These single-ASID instruction variants are also affected by SiFive errata CIP-1200. Until now, the errata workaround was not needed for the single-ASID sfence.vma variants, because they were only used when the ASID allocator was enabled, and the affected SiFive platforms do not support multiple ASIDs. However, we are going to start using those sfence.vma variants regardless of ASID support, so now we need alternatives covering them.
